AIMBE is excited to share a recent press release from the Heart Rhythm Society Journal spotlighting new articles on the role of fluoropolymers in medical devices & delivery systems—and the patient risks posed by sweeping PFAS regulations! go.bsky.app/redirect?u=htt… 🧵 See Below (1/4) 👇

AIMBE (@aimbe) 's Twitter Profile Photo

These articles detail the use of fluoropolymers in life-saving devices—and the implications of PFAS regulations on patient care. Article 1 (Role of PFAS): bit.ly/4nXer7m Article 2 (PFAS Regulation): bit.ly/4lHvGYD Editorial: bit.ly/3Ivzbmm (2/4)

Fewer side-effects, more effectiveness. Mike Mitchell's lab redesigned mRNA lipid nanoparticles using olive oil-inspired chemistry. Adding phenol groups reduces inflammation, making mRNA therapies safer & more effective. "It's a win-win," says Mitchell.
